Business Readiness Specialist

Summary of the role

Due to internal progression, we are currently looking for a Business Readiness Specialist who will be working with the Readiness Manager to look after the engagement and preparation of the operation (Voice, Back Office and Complaints) to accept changes and maintain service levels. This role is responsible for ensuring the facts and details are correct so that the project deliverables will meet the needs of the stakeholders, legislation, and standards, enabling good outcomes for customers.

What you’ll be doing
  • Understanding and developing project aims and scope to work as a Business Readiness subject matter expert in tandem with Business Analyst and PM.
  • Liaising with Operations to ensure projects meet operational requirements.
  • Designing comms to effectively communicate change to stakeholders.
  • Work collaboratively with the training team to ensure training material is designed to enable Agents to understand and embed the change
  • Managing delivery documentation such as Action Logs, Timelines and Risk Management.
  • Being the voice of the customer and colleagues to ensure we deliver change for the right reason.
  • Supporting the deployment of new systems, processes and applications to confirm if these are fit for purpose.
  • Helping with the development of Q&A docs to support any event mailings.
  • Ensuring any changes that are being delivered create good customer outcomes and do not cause customer harm
What we’re looking for
  • Ideally have a good understanding of our operations and systems.
  • Knowledge of Project Management or Delivery
  • Stakeholder management & engagement
  • Ideally have change management experience.
  • Able to use Microsoft Excel, Teams, PowerPoint & Word.
  • Organise your workload based on prioritisation and adapt to changes in priority.
Desirable

Knowledge of Life, Pensions & Investment (LPI) products and FCA regulations.

Qualifications either APM or Price2
